Saint Valentine's Day  (snt)
n.
February 14, celebrated in various American and European countries by the exchange of valentines or love tokens. Also called Valentine's Day.

[Primarily after Saint Valentine.]

Saint Valentine's Day
n usually abbreviated to St Valentine's Day
Feb. 14, the day on which valentines are exchanged, originally connected with the pagan festival of Lupercalia
